Transaction 468fe796ec934d8149844dc84a644794059c6d85c66c950414ecdb78f9d23617
1 Input
1 Output
-
468fe796ec934d8149844dc84a644794059c6d85c66c950414ecdb78f9d23617:0
- value
- 839768
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d57730e6f49c734611d61cbcd68cfffe633b224b OP_EQUAL
- address
- 3M9idwYMn4kpYcgKPwqXHXAWU2JYMz4aij